Yesterday, Google announced in a blog post that Android Wear was changing its name to Wear OS, a rebranding designed to reflect the fact that one in three Android Wear users also uses an iPhone. The company hopes to make it more obvious that devices running the wearable operating system are compatible with Apple devices as well, something which has been the case since 2015. "As our technology and partnerships have evolved, so have our users," Wear OS Director of Project Management Dennis Troper wrote in a short blog post announcing the name change.
